What Marque Ventures Fellowship is
The Marque Ventures Fellowship integrates military personnel, veterans, government civilians, and military spouses into the operational infrastructure of a venture capital firm specializing in national security and defense technology. The program functions as both professional development and talent pipeline for emerging leaders transitioning into private capital markets focused on government-critical innovation.

Compensation and economics
This is an unpaid fellowship, although some participants may receive employer sponsorship through various DoD and private funding mechanisms.

Program thesis
Marque Ventures aims to connect visionary founders with defense customers by rebuilding bridges between the Department of Defense and private industry. The fellowship enables military-experienced talent to gain cutting-edge exposure to venture capital mechanics while contributing domain expertise that improves investment quality in defense and deep tech sectors.
Eligibility
The program welcomes fellows from diverse professional, educational, and seniority backgrounds, including active and reserve service members, veterans, government civilians, and military spouses.

Delivery model
The program is fully remote with optional in-person events and conference attendance.
Participation expectations
The program is designed for part-time participation, allowing fellows to maintain existing employment or obligations.

What participants may receive
Participants gain exposure to cutting-edge defense and emerging technology landscapes, early-stage company viability assessment frameworks, and connections between startups and warfighting/policy organizations.
